monsoon, on Jun 23 2004, 08:41 PM, said:

Is that building called the Superman building because of the 1950 TV series?
Supposedly, it is the building that Superman in the 50s series flies infront of. I've never seen any evidence that this is the case, I think it just looks like that building so it became known as that.
